stain, discoloration, discolouration(noun)a soiled or discolored appearance
"the wine left a dark stain"
stain(noun)(microscopy) a dye or other coloring material that is used in microscopy to make structures visible
dirt, filth, grime, soil, stain, grease, grunge(noun)the state of being covered with unclean things
mark, stigma, brand, stain(noun)a symbol of disgrace or infamy
"And the Lord set a mark upon Cain"--Genesis
blot, smear, smirch, spot, stain(verb)an act that brings discredit to the person who does it
"he made a huge blot on his copybook"
stain(verb)color with a liquid dye or tint
"Stain this table a beautiful walnut color"; "people knew how to stain glass a beautiful blue in the middle ages"
stain(verb)produce or leave stains
"Red wine stains the table cloth"
tarnish, stain, maculate, sully, defile(verb)make dirty or spotty, as by exposure to air; also used metaphorically
"The silver was tarnished by the long exposure to the air"; "Her reputation was sullied after the affair with a married man"
stain(verb)color for microscopic study
"The laboratory worker dyed the specimen"
to affect slightly with something morally bad or undesirableher poor choice of companions stained her reputation somewhat
to give color or a different color tostained the table to look like cherry
to make dirtyoil stained his work pants
a mark of guilt or disgracethe stain of this cowardly act would haunt him for the rest of his career
a substance used to color other materialsapplied several coats of stain to the wood
